style(接口测试): 修复接口测试报告平铺模式子请求背景显示style
This commit is contained in:
parent
0d9d396fa0
commit
623b69c6b9
|
@ -87,7 +87,7 @@
|
||||||
</a-popover>
|
</a-popover>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div v-if="activeType === 'SubRequest'" class="my-4 flex justify-start">
|
<div v-if="activeType === 'SubRequest'" class="flex justify-start bg-white py-4">
|
||||||
<MsPagination
|
<MsPagination
|
||||||
v-model:page-size="pageSize"
|
v-model:page-size="pageSize"
|
||||||
v-model:current="current"
|
v-model:current="current"
|
||||||
|
@ -101,6 +101,7 @@
|
||||||
<a-spin v-if="props.mode === 'tiled'" class="w-full" :loading="loading">
|
<a-spin v-if="props.mode === 'tiled'" class="w-full" :loading="loading">
|
||||||
<Suspense>
|
<Suspense>
|
||||||
<TiledDisplay
|
<TiledDisplay
|
||||||
|
:active-type="activeType"
|
||||||
:menu-list="responseCompositionTabList"
|
:menu-list="responseCompositionTabList"
|
||||||
:request-result="activeStepDetailCopy?.content"
|
:request-result="activeStepDetailCopy?.content"
|
||||||
:console="props.console"
|
:console="props.console"
|
||||||
|
|
|
@ -3,7 +3,10 @@
|
||||||
<!-- 展开折叠列表 -->
|
<!-- 展开折叠列表 -->
|
||||||
<div v-if="props.requestResult?.responseResult.responseCode" class="tiledList">
|
<div v-if="props.requestResult?.responseResult.responseCode" class="tiledList">
|
||||||
<div v-for="item of props.menuList" :key="item.value" class="menu-list-wrapper">
|
<div v-for="item of props.menuList" :key="item.value" class="menu-list-wrapper">
|
||||||
<div v-if="isShowContent(item.value)" class="menu-list">
|
<div
|
||||||
|
v-if="isShowContent(item.value)"
|
||||||
|
:class="`${props.activeType === 'SubRequest' ? 'top-[90px]' : 'top-[38px]'} menu-list`"
|
||||||
|
>
|
||||||
<div class="flex items-center">
|
<div class="flex items-center">
|
||||||
<MsButton
|
<MsButton
|
||||||
v-if="!expandIds.includes(item.value)"
|
v-if="!expandIds.includes(item.value)"
|
||||||
|
@ -87,6 +90,7 @@
|
||||||
requestResult?: RequestResult;
|
requestResult?: RequestResult;
|
||||||
console?: string;
|
console?: string;
|
||||||
environmentName?: string;
|
environmentName?: string;
|
||||||
|
activeType: string; // 激活类型
|
||||||
menuList: { label: string; value: keyof typeof ResponseComposition }[];
|
menuList: { label: string; value: keyof typeof ResponseComposition }[];
|
||||||
reportId?: string;
|
reportId?: string;
|
||||||
}>();
|
}>();
|
||||||
|
@ -167,7 +171,6 @@
|
||||||
.menu-list-wrapper {
|
.menu-list-wrapper {
|
||||||
.menu-list {
|
.menu-list {
|
||||||
position: sticky;
|
position: sticky;
|
||||||
top: 50px;
|
|
||||||
z-index: 999999;
|
z-index: 999999;
|
||||||
height: 40px;
|
height: 40px;
|
||||||
line-height: 40px;
|
line-height: 40px;
|
||||||
|
|
Loading…
Reference in New Issue